## v3.8.0 — Changed defaults

Heads up, on-call folks: the Pairwell matching service was hitting GC pauses north of 900ms during peak matching runs, which tripped the liveness probe and caused pointless restarts. We've swapped the default collector and bumped the heap headroom so pauses stay under 100ms. You shouldn't need to intervene, but if latency alerts fire, check the pause histogram first. The new defaults ship as follows.

settings of fawip-yadug:
[druath]
port = 3000
region = north-4
host = druath.qirvanworks.corp
timeout_ms = 1500
retries = 1

**Handover Note — Front Desk, Visitor Handling**

Morning, Petra. Overnight we had two visitors pre-registered for Calloway Instruments; their lanyards are in the second drawer. Please remember all visitors must be escorted past the atrium at Windlemere House, and sign-out times go in the red ledger. If a visitor needs the accessible entrance before 08:00, the side-door keypad takes the code below.

door code, yagap-bahof: bdg-O-05

- [ ] **Step 7: Breaker override escrow.** After sealing the signing keys for the Tallgrove upstream API circuit breaker, confirm the support team can force the breaker open during a full outage. The override bundle lives in the sealed escrow drawer and is useless without its unlock phrase. Two ceremony witnesses must initial this step before proceeding. The escrow bundle is decrypted with the recovery passphrase that follows.

vault phrase of kahip-kahop = holath-quenmir